Although numerous roof covering materials are offered, asphalt shingles stick out as a popular option due to their price and versatility. They can be found in two main kinds: fiberglass and organic. Fiberglass roof shingles are lighter, more resistant to wetness, and commonly more affordable, while organic roof shingles provide a thicker, a lot more long lasting choice. Both types are made to stand up to different weather, making them ideal for various climates.You'll appreciate the wide array of colors and styles readily available, allowing you to match your home's visual appeals easily. Additionally, asphalt shingles can last in between 15 to 30 years with appropriate maintenance. Their ease of installation also means quicker task completion, saving you money and time. On the whole, asphalt tiles are a dependable roof option for several homeowners.
Metal Roof Advantages
Steel roof uses a range of significant advantages that make it an engaging choice for homeowners. It's exceptionally long lasting, enduring 40-70 years with minimal maintenance, significantly exceeding conventional materials. You'll likewise profit from its resistance to severe climate, consisting of high winds and hefty snow. Additionally, metal roofs reflect solar energy, keeping your home cooler in the summer and potentially lowering energy bills. Their lightweight nature means less stress and anxiety on your structure, and many metal roofing options are made from recycled products, making them eco-friendly. And also, with a selection of colors and styles readily available, you can conveniently locate a style that matches your home's aesthetic. Have you ever before regreted about employing a roofer? You're not alone. Regrettably, scams prevail in the roof covering market. Roofing Contractor Melbourne. Usually, scammers use incredibly reduced prices to entice you in. Once they obtain the job, they cut edges or do shabby work. To prevent this, always research study possible contractors. Check their on the internet testimonials and ask for references.Another red flag is high-pressure sales strategies. Stroll away if a contractor insists on starting the task promptly or requires complete settlement upfront. Trustworthy service providers understand you need time to make decisions.Also, be cautious of door-to-door salespeople. They might declare storm damage or offer "limited-time deals." Always verify their credentials and insurance coverage before signing anything. By staying notified and cautious, you can shield on your own from roof covering rip-offs and assure you obtain the high quality solution you should have

Cleaning your rain gutters often is crucial for keeping a long-lasting roofing system. Blocked rain gutters can cause water accumulation, which might trigger leaks and damage to your roofing system and home's foundation. To avoid this, make it a routine to inspect your rain gutters at the very least twice a year, particularly before and after heavy rainfall periods. Eliminate leaves, twigs, and debris to guarantee water moves openly. If you're comfy doing so, utilize a ladder; otherwise, consider hiring a professional. Assume regarding setting up gutter guards to decrease future obstructions. Keep in mind, clean gutters not just secure your roofing system but additionally improve your home's overall allure.
